My moitor, an Iiyama Vision Master Pro 510, has never been detected
correctly since my foray into Ubuntu.

What has been a nuisance previously, is now a show-stopping fail, due to
the implementation of 'bulletproofX' - and the removal of the very
useful resolution-changing keyboard shortcuts.

On boot, with both the live and an installed version (using the alternate install cd), I get a flashing purple screen when the login screen should be displayed. I can login but to no avail as the desktop isn't displayed correctly.
I can also switch to the teminal, but usuage is made difficult by the fact that it is invisible.

Currently, Ubuntu is completely unusable for me.
